A Certified Professional in Piezoelectric Energy Conversion certification program equips individuals with the knowledge and skills to design, implement, and maintain piezoelectric energy harvesting systems. The curriculum focuses on practical application and problem-solving, crucial for success in this rapidly growing field.
Learning outcomes typically include a comprehensive understanding of piezoelectric materials, energy conversion principles, circuit design for energy harvesting, and system integration techniques. Students also develop proficiency in modeling and simulation software relevant to piezoelectric device design and energy system optimization. This includes skills in power electronics and signal processing relevant to energy harvesting applications.
The duration of a Certified Professional in Piezoelectric Energy Conversion program varies depending on the institution and program intensity, ranging from several weeks for intensive courses to a year or more for comprehensive programs, possibly including research projects and hands-on laboratory experience. Some programs might offer flexible online learning options.
